Responsibilities

  • Navigation watchkeeping duties
  • Mooring and unmooring operations
  • Deck maintenance
  • Loading/unloading operations
  • Support for specialised Multicat vessel operations
  • Additional sector information: On Multicat vessels, the AB typically participates in towing operations, dynamic positioning, underwater work, and operation of specialised equipment such as cranes and winches.
